I Want It AllRise Against

Hailing from Chicago and active since 1999, the melodic hardcore band Rise Against delivered a powerful new song released in May 2025, and it’s a standout.
Made as the lead single for their tenth album, “Ricochet,” the track features the band’s signature aggressive guitar riffs and high-energy vocals, along with a memorable call-and-response anthem.
Produced by Grammy winner Catherine Marks, it maintains the spirit of punk rock while achieving a more polished sound.
It’s an ideal pick for those seeking music with strong social messages or anyone looking for an energizing boost.

ATTENTION!Kesha, Slayyyter, Rose Gray

It’s a truly breathtaking collaboration where three powerful personalities leading the pop scene collide.
This track, featuring U.S.
artists Kesha and Slayyyter alongside the U.K.’s rising star Rose Gray, delivers a dance-pop sound polished with shimmering Y2K-style synths.
It’s a bold anthem of liberation about stealing the gaze of others and shining by your own rules.
Released in June 2025 via Kesha’s own label, it also stands out as the lead single from the album ‘.’.
Put it on when you want a boost and some confidence—you’ll feel unstoppable.

WaveAsake, Central Cee

A collaboration track by Nigeria’s Asake and the UK’s Central Cee that fuses Afrobeats with UK hip-hop.
Released in June 2024, the song showcases a seamless blend of their distinct styles.
It features an uptempo rhythm and an energetic, dynamic melody that makes you want to move as soon as you hear it.
The music video uses iconic locations in Lagos as its backdrop, adding a rich cultural appeal.
It’s the perfect song to play before heading out in the morning or when you need a quick mood boost.
Stop Playing With MeTyler, The Creator

A true maverick who effortlessly transcends the bounds of hip-hop, Tyler, the Creator delivers an ultra-groovy track that fuses funk and jazz.
It’s as if that pent-up “enough already” frustration is being transformed into dance over a thunderous beat.
His intense moves in the music video are a straight-up explosion of bottled-up energy.
The song is featured on the album “Don’t Tap the Glass,” which dropped unexpectedly in July 2025, and the video sparked huge buzz with appearances by big names like LeBron James.
It’s the perfect track for when you just want to move your body or blast away those lingering blues!
FireHouse Of Protection

A punkish blast of sound featuring fierce guitar riffs and piercing, high-pitched sirens! This is the advance single from the American rock duo House of Protection—formed by former FEVER 333 members Aric Improta and Stephen Harrison—off their EP “Outrun You All,” slated for release in May 2025.
The track combines dance-inducing contagion with mosh-pit intensity, and drew major buzz during the band’s early-2025 Australia tour with Bad Omens and Poppy.
Songs from “Outrun You All” were produced by Jordan Fish, formerly of BRING ME THE HORIZON, brilliantly fusing explosive energy with electronic elements.
It’s a powerful cut that will ignite both the dance floor and the live house—don’t miss it.
